Nestled in the heart of Texas Hill Country just outside vibrant Dripping Springs (11 Mins to Dipping Springs High School, Dripping Springs Middle School and Walnut Springs Elementary School), this rare unrestricted 68-acre estate offers privacy, luxury, and true freedom. Minutes from town’s distilleries, wineries, breweries, and top schools, yet worlds away with easy access to Austin (~30-45 min). The custom modern farmhouse boasts elegant stone and board-and-batten siding, a sleek metal roof, expansive windows, and seamless indoor-outdoor flow under a canopy of mature live oaks. Step outside to the resort-style pool overlooking rolling hills and breathtaking sunsets—perfect for entertaining or serene escapes. Equestrian enthusiasts will appreciate the established horse facilities: a spacious 4 stall barn with covered areas, tack room, Bumk Room w/ full Bathroom, 4.5 acre fenced turn out pasture, and trailer storage, set amid open pastures ideal for grazing or riding. The standout party barn—with covered porch, large doors, studio apartment and outdoor ambiance—serves as an ideal event space, workshop, guest retreat, or hobby haven. A scenic wet weather creek threads through the property, enhancing natural beauty and attracting wildlife, while gently rolling terrain, native grasses, and ancient oaks evoke authentic Texas ranch living. With no restrictions, envision your dream: expand the equestrian setup, add structures, start a vineyard, create a family compound, or simply enjoy the freedom of 68+ acres of prime Hill Country land.
